[ARCHIVED] Smart911 Now Available in Onslow County

Smart911 Webstory

Callers to Onslow County’s 9-1-1 center now have an option to enhance the information that operators can use to help improve emergency responses to your home or business. 

Onslow County has partnered with Smart911 to offer enhanced 9-1-1 services to all Citizens. The free service can provide critical information to first responders at the time your phone connects to the Onslow County 9-1-1 center. 

Information about medical conditions of residents of your home, blood types, and notes about emergency procedures you would like them to know in an emergency. 

Residents can create a Safety Profile by using the Smart911 online portal or by downloading the Smart911 app. Then when a 9-1-1 call is made, the information in your Safety Profile becomes available to first responders. 

The Safety Profile can include as much or as little information as residents wish to share. Many Citizens elect to share their home address, something cell phone calls are unable automatically provide to telecommunicators. It can also include information about your household such elderly members and even photos of household members. 

“Having background information pop-up on the screen is a real time-saver when seconds count,” said Ray Silance, Onslow County Telecommunications Division Head. “If you have a family member with a medical condition they might not be able to communicate when there is an emergency, this program could communicate that vital information instantly when the call is made to 9-1-1.” 

Create your free Safety Profile today at Smart911.com  or by downloading the Smart911 app from Google Play Store or the Apple Store. Any information you share is private and secure, is only used for emergency responses, and only made available to the 9-1-1 system in the event of an emergency call.
